Brief summary

This is an open-label multicenter, study to assess the pharmacokinetic interaction of rifampin with ABT-199 in up to 12 subjects with relapsed or refractory non-Hodgkin's lymphoma.

Detailed description

This is a Phase 1 study designed to assess how the body processes the study drug ABT-199 when taken alone and in combination with rifampin and to assess the safety of ABT-199 in combination with rifampin. Subjects may enroll in a separate extension study to continue receiving ABT-199 after completion of this study.

Exclusion criteria

. * Subject has an Eastern Cooperative Oncology Group (ECOG) performance score of 0 to 2. * Subject must have adequate bone marrow (independent of growth factor support per local laboratory reference range), coagulation, renal and hepatic function: * Absolute Neutrophil Count (ANC) greater than or equal to 1000/µL (without growth factor support unless neutropenia is clearly due to underlying disease); * Platelets greater than or equal to 75,000/mm3 (unless thrombocytopenia is clearly due to disease-related immune thrombocytopenia or to underlying disease; entry platelet count must be independent of transfusion within 14 days of Screening); * Hemoglobin greater than or equal to 9.0 g/dL (unless anemia is clearly due to underlying disease; entry hemoglobin must be independent of transfusion within 14 days of Screening); * If cytopenias are present, no evidence of myelodysplastic syndrome or hypoplastic bone marrow; * Subject must have activated partial thromboplastin time (aPTT) and prothrombin time (PT) not to exceed 1.5 × the upper normal limit (ULN); * Calculated creatinine clearance greater than or equal to 50 mL/min using a 24-hour urine collection for creatinine clearance or per the Cockcroft-Gault equation; * Alanine aminotransferase (ALT) and aspartate aminotransferase (AST) less than or equal to 3.0 × ULN of institution's normal range; * Bilirubin less than or equal to 1.5 × ULN. Subjects with Gilbert's Syndrome may have a bilirubin greater than 1.5 × ULN per discussion with the AbbVie medical monitor.

Design outcomes

Primary

MeasureTime frameDescription
Determination of maximum observed plasma concentration (Cmax), time to Cmax (peak time, Tmax), terminal phase elimination rate constant (beta), terminal phase elimination half-life (t1/2), & area under the plasma concentration-time curve (AUC) of ABT-199Measured pre-dose and up to 96 hours post-dose ABT-199Blood samples for pharmacokinetic (PK) analysis of ABT-199 will be collected at designated timepoints to assess the PK parameters for ABT-199 alone relative to ABT-199 with rifampin
